I am a very happy v4.5HF3 user but I think it is time to move my B737 cockpit to V5.2. There seems to be many good reports.

My view group is a 4 LCD screen, outside view, producing nearly seamless a 210 degree view.

My question is: Can I just copy and paste the existing view group file, over from v4.5 to v5.2, or is it a new file format or structure?

I answered my own question after purchasing and installing V5.2.

I copied the two files over from v4.5 in the App Data folder to v5.2 and it works perfectly.

Just tried v 5.2 HF1 and any issues there were with view-groups and multiple video cards seem to have been resolved, now working perfectly (with my original viewgroups.xml file!) on a vanilla install of v5.2HF1. If anyone had similar issues to me then I'd consider updating. Thanks LM!
